WebJul 15, 2024 · Studies of habit formation generally suggest a timeframe that ranges from a couple of weeks to a couple of months. People often assume you either have a habit or you don’t, Gardner says. “But it varies on a continuum.” And even once you have formed a habit, it is always possible to backslide.
